How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Brantford West?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brantford West Studio Apartments | $1,484 | $1,449 | $1,499 |
| Brantford West 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,605 | $1,400 | $1,899 |
| Brantford West 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,883 | $1,399 | $2,100 |
| Brantford West 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,562 | $1,975 | $6,087 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Brantford West
How much are Studio apartments in Brantford West?
There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in Brantford West with rent ranges from $1,449 to $1,499 with an average price of $1,484.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brantford West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brantford West ranges from $1,400 to $1,899 with an average monthly rent of $1,605.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brantford West c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brantford West range from $1,399 to $2,100.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,883.
